VIEW MANAGEMENT
Visibility/Graphics Overrides
This section shows how to have the ability to turn on and turn off all the categories in a view.
View ► Graphics ► Visibility Graphics. It is also possible to select the
function from the View Properties.
Shortcut: VV or VG.
Model Categories The area contains the model information. These are objects
that are accessible in the construction project, for example.
walls, columns, etc.
Annotation Categories Showing the help items that are used to design, but which
are not available in this construction project.
Example: section, dimensions, texts etc.
Analytical Model Categories This group contains analytical information for the objects that
can be used for loads.
It is suitable for construction engineers.
Imported Categories Showing imported files structure.
Example: DWG file's layers.
Filters Here, you can create and manage filters to get the look you
want.
NOTE:
These setups can be saved in View Templates and reused in multiple views and possibly. other
projects.
